Q: Is 239,478 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 239,478 is not a prime number.

Why is 239,478 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 239478 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 167 239 334 478 501 717 1,002 1,434 39,913 79,826 119,739 and 239,478, with no remainder.

Since 239,478 cannot be divided by just 1 and 239,478, it is not a prime number.
